Private Capital AUM Reaches Rs. 10.50 Lakh Crore: A Closer Look at the Growth
Real Estate:In a significant milestone for the Indian financial market, the private capital assets under management (AUM) have reached Rs.
10.50 lakh crore.
This growth can be attributed to various factors, including a rise in per-capita income and increasing aspirations among the populace to acquire property and other assets.
According to industry experts, the trend is expected to continue, buoyed by favorable economic conditions and a robust investment environment.The rise in private capital AUM is a clear indicator of the growing trust and confidence in the Indian financial market.
As more and more individuals and institutions seek to diversify their investment portfolios, private capital has emerged as an attractive option.
The sector has seen substantial growth over the past few years, with a particular focus on real estate, infrastructure, and technology. InformationCafemutual, a leading financial advisory firm, has been closely monitoring the growth of private capital AUM in India.
The firm’s experts believe that the rise in AUM is a reflection of the improving economic landscape and the increasing affluence of the Indian middle class.
They attribute the growth to several key factors 1.
Increasing Per-Capita Income As the Indian economy continues to grow, per-capita income has seen a significant rise.
This has led to increased disposable income, which in turn has fueled demand for investments in private capital.2.
Rising Aspirations The Indian middle class is becoming more aspirational, with a growing desire to own property and other valuable assets.
This has driven demand for real estate and other investment opportunities.3.
Favorable Economic Conditions The overall economic environment in India has been favorable, with stable inflation, low interest rates, and a robust GDP growth rate.
These conditions have made it an attractive market for both domestic and foreign investors.4.
Investment Opportunities The private capital sector offers a wide range of investment opportunities, from real estate and infrastructure to technology and startups.
This diversity has made it an appealing choice for investors looking to diversify their portfolios. Impact on the EconomyThe growth in private capital AUM has had a positive impact on the Indian economy.
It has led to increased investment in key sectors such as real estate, infrastructure, and technology, which are crucial for the country's development.
This, in turn, has created jobs and driven economic growth. Challenges and OpportunitiesWhile the growth in private capital AUM is a positive development, it is not without challenges.
The sector needs to address issues such as regulatory compliance, transparency, and risk management to ensure sustainable growth.
